Create a Solid Budgetary Plan

To keep your new business from going into debt, you should make a budget. This will help you with understanding the core differences between the "must-haves" and the "wants" in every aspect of your business. Approximately 59% of entrepreneurs who ask for a loan utilize it to grow their company. This guarantees you aren't obtaining business loans and mortgages on the spur of the moment without truly understanding how much you're investing.
The importance of establishing and sticking to a company budget cannot be overstated. You may utilize loans to pay down unneeded spending so you can focus on longer-term expenditures in your company, such as hiring new employees and modernization.
Automate Financial Processes
Automating financial operations eliminates mistakes and keeps costs down when you can't afford to engage a specialist for certain duties. Consider invoicing. Based on your preferred tool, you now have access to hundreds of models for making company invoices. You won't have to start fresh every time you need to submit an invoice using automation.
This may not appear to save you a significant amount of time. However, it does add up. Financial automation, for instance, may save you a regular workweek over a year if you save one hour every week.
Reinvest In Your Business
Enjoy your small business's successes when it sees quick growth and increasing earnings. But don't lose sight of your long-term objectives. Make sure to put profits back into your business. Your company will keep growing in this manner.
Reward yourself and your colleagues for their efforts. Don't go overboard, though. Rather, add more staff, increase your marketing budget, or investigate new channels or solutions to assist your company flourishes. Maintain the momentum.
